Ha! Agree with you about the UI, and I have raised this myself on here, although many seem to believe that is not important. Clearly, it is, because it makes the service look old fashioned and puts people off if they are used to Sky Q and BT. However, the interface will be changing as the new Horizon UI is rolled out across Europe. Not sure how long it will take to get here though.

I don't have the issues with PQ that you have mentioned. I presume you have tried out the various settings on your V6 and the TV.

I tend not to watch much of Virgin's on demand apart from the Virgin Exclusives because I record the things I want to see, so I cannot comment with great authority on series missing episodes. However, as far as catch up is concerned, did you know you could go back to programmes already shown on the EPG and view them from there? That may solve that problem for you.

Personally, I am quite pleased with the service. It would be better if the V6s could record more. I have two - one in the lounge and one in the bedroom, and I can record on each as well as watch the bedroom recordings in the lounge and vice versa. Better than the Sky mini-box idea, because you cannot record on them.

Recording in HD, the 1MB capacity on the hard drive is not good enough really and I have to use my DVD recorder to give me a further 500 hours worth of HD recordings.

I love the fact that I can bookmark my Netflix shows so that they appear with all my recordings (without taking up recording space) and I prefer Virgin's on demand system in that you can just watch the programmes as soon as you select them, without having to download them first.

In the end, lightmyfire, I guess you just have to choose the best system that suits you.
